Output d76fc37491cebfd05515c8342b608db2f626138d4b657615fc8d90d7ca994836:17

value
124392494
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 94556405a795990336b2c71c58b3dd01f7c1aa94 OP_EQUALVERIFY OP_CHECKSIG
address
1EXKJScKrYesM8kBRpy89mHQERT4XtkVUa
transaction
d76fc37491cebfd05515c8342b608db2f626138d4b657615fc8d90d7ca994836
spent
true